G
WARNING
During vehicle operation, the boiling
point of the brake fluid is continuously reduced through the absorption of moisture
from the atmosphere. Under extremely
strenuous operating conditions, this
moisture content can lead to the formation
of
bubbles in the system, thus reducing the
system’s efficiency.
Therefore, the brake fluid must be replaced
regularly. Refer to your vehicle’s
Maintenance Booklet for replacement
interval.
The brake fluid level in the brake fluid
reservoir may be too low if the brake
warning lamp in the instrument cluster
comes on (Y page 22) although the parking
brake is released.
! If you find that the brake fluid in the
brake fluid reservoir has fallen to the
minimum mark or below, have the brake
system checked for brake pad thickness
and leaks immediately. Contact an
authorized smart center immediately. Do
not add brake fluid as this will not solve
the problem.

Tire Pressure Monitoring System (TPMS)* Your vehicle may be equipped with a Tire
Pressure
Monitoring System (TPMS). It monitors the tire inflation pressure in
all
four tires. A warning is issued to alert
you to a decrease in pressure in one or more
of the tires.
The Tire Pressure Monitoring System
(TPMS) is equipped with a combination low
tire pressure/TPMS malfunction telltale in
the instrument cluster. Depending on how
the telltale illuminates, it indicates a low
tire pressure condition or a malfunction in
the TPMS system itself:
R If the telltale illuminates continuously,
one or more of your tires is significantly
underinflated. There is no malfunction
in the TPMS.
R If the telltale flashes for 60 seconds and
then stays illuminated, the TPMS system
itself is not operating properly.
The TPMS only functions on wheels that are
equipped with the proper electronic
sensors. G

Restarting the TPMS
G
WARNING
It is the driver’s responsibility to
calibrate the TPMS on the recommended
cold inflation pressure. Underinflated
tires affect the ability to steer or brake
and might cause you to lose control of the
vehicle.
When you restart the TPMS, the system sets
new reference values for each tire.
The TPMS must be restarted when you have
adjusted the tire inflation pressure to a
new
level (e.g. because of different load or
driving conditions). The TPMS is then
recalibrated to the current tire inflation
pressures.
X Using the Tire and Loading Information
placard on the driver’s door B‑pillar
(Y page 130), make sure the tire
inflation pressure of all four tires is
correct.
i Restart the TPMS after adjusting the
tire inflation pressure to the inflation
pressure recommended for the vehicle
operating condition. Tire pressure
should only be adjusted on cold tires.
Observe the recommended tire inflation
pressure on the Tire and Loading
Information
placard on the driver’s door
B‑pillar (Y page 130). X
Press Restarting TPMS button :.
The
combination low tire pressure/TPMS
malfunction telltale in the instrument
cluster (Y page 22) flashes for approximately 5 seconds and then goes
out.
After driving a few minutes the system
verifies that the current tire inflation
pressures are within the system’s
specified range. Afterwards the current
tire inflation pressures are accepted as
reference pressures and then monitored. Maximum tire inflation pressure

High and low stresses G
WARNING
Resting your foot on the brake pedal will
cause excessive and premature wear of the
brake pads.
It can also result in the brakes
overheating, thereby significantly
reducing their effectiveness and your
ability to stop the vehicle in sufficient
time to avoid an accident.
After
hard braking, it is advisable to drive
on for some time, rather than immediately
park, so that the air stream will cool down
the brakes faster.
If your brake system is normally only
subjected to moderate loads, you should
occasionally test the effectiveness of the
brakes by applying above-normal braking
pressure at higher speeds. This will also
enhance the grip of the brake pads. G

Your vehicle has also been equipped with a TPMS malfunction indicator to indicate when
the
system is not operating properly. The TPMS malfunction indicator is combined with the
low tire pressure telltale. When the system detects a malfunction, the telltale will flash for
approximately 1 minute and then remain continuously illuminated.
This sequence will continue upon subsequent vehicle start-ups as long as the malfunction
exists. When the malfunction indicator is illuminated, the system may not be able to detect
or signal low tire pressure as intended.
TPMS malfunctions may occur for a variety of reasons, including the installation of
incompatible replacement or alternate tires or wheels on the vehicle that prevent the TPMS
from functioning properly. Always check the TPMS malfunction telltale after replacing one
or more tires or wheels on your vehicle to ensure that the replacement or alternate tires
and wheels allow the TPMS to continue to function properly. Display messages Possible causes/consequences and

Vehicle handling characteristics of a tire
sealant repaired tire may change. Adapt
your driving accordingly.
X After driving for about 1.8 miles (3 km)
or
ten minutes, stop and exit the vehicle
taking all of the appropriate safety
precautions.
X Take the tire repair kit from the vehicle.
X Screw the end of filler hose ? onto tire
valve G.
X Check the tire inflation pressure using
pressure gauge ;. G
WARNING
If tire inflation pressure has fallen below
130 kPa (1.3 bar, 19 psi) do not continue to
drive the vehicle.
Park your vehicle safely away from the
roadway and contact the nearest smart
center or call Roadside Assistance.
Have the damaged tire replaced.
X If the tire inflation pressure is at least
130
kPa (1.3 bar, 19 psi), inflate or deflate
the tire to correct tire inflation
pressure (see Tire and Loading
Information placard located on the
driver’s door B‑pillar). R
